Manager, Data Analytics DePuy Synthes is recruiting for a Manager, Data Analytics, located in Raynham, Massachusetts or West Chester, PA or Warsaw, IN, or Palm Beach Gardens, FL.
Job Overview The Manager, Data Analytics is responsible for leading regulatory data analytics and reporting activities to enable informed decision making, improve compliance visibility, and support regulatory strategy execution. This role transforms complex regulatory and compliance data into actionable insights, supporting business priorities, operational excellence, and regulatory readiness. The position partners closely with Regulatory Affairs, Quality, IT, Project Management, and other business stakeholders to strengthen data governance, analytics capabilities, and performance reporting across the organization.
Key Responsibilities
Lead Regulatory Affairs data analytics activities, including development of dashboards, reports, and performance metrics.
Analyze regulatory and compliance data to identify trends, risks, and opportunities for improvement.
Partner with cross‑functional stakeholders to define data requirements and ensure data accuracy and integrity.
Provide input and distill information from the Strategy, Governance, and Insights team.
Understand the regulatory data, meanings, and implications to support regulatory operations and leadership with insights for strategic and operational decisions.
Establish and maintain data governance standards, reporting frameworks, and analytics best practices.
Support audits, inspections, and internal reviews by providing accurate regulatory data and analysis.
Monitor evolving regulatory data and reporting requirements and assess impacts on analytics solutions.
Drive continuous improvement initiatives to enhance regulatory analytics capabilities and efficiency.
